Why Choose Murrisk for Your Log Cabin Escape?

Murrisk is more than just a pretty backdrop; it’s a destination brimming with character and opportunity. Its strategic location makes it an ideal starting point for exploring the Wild Atlantic Way, a renowned scenic driving route that showcases the rugged beauty of Ireland’s west coast. Beyond the iconic Croagh Patrick, the area boasts pristine beaches perfect for bracing walks or even a brave dip in the ocean. The historic Ballintubber Abbey, a magnificent medieval abbey that has been in continuous use for over 800 years, is just a short drive away, offering a glimpse into Ireland’s deep religious and architectural past. Furthermore, the vibrant town of Westport, with its lively pubs, diverse restaurants, and charming shops, is easily accessible, providing a perfect balance of tranquility and lively entertainment.

Activities and Adventures Around Your Murrisk Log Cabin

Your log cabin in Murrisk is not just a place to rest; it’s your gateway to a world of adventure. For the physically inclined, the ascent of Croagh Patrick is a rite of passage, offering unparalleled views from its summit. The surrounding countryside is crisscrossed with walking trails, catering to all levels of fitness, from gentle strolls along the coast to more challenging hikes in the Nephin Beg Mountains. Water sports enthusiasts will find plenty to do in Clew Bay, with options for kayaking, paddleboarding, and sailing. Fishing is also a popular activity, with opportunities for both sea and freshwater angling.

Exploring the Cultural and Natural Wonders

Beyond the physical activities, Murrisk and its surroundings are steeped in history and natural beauty. A visit to the National Famine Memorial, located near the Murrisk Abbey ruins, is a poignant and important experience, offering a profound insight into Ireland’s past. For those interested in local folklore and mythology, the tales woven into the fabric of this landscape are captivating. Consider taking a scenic drive along the Wild Atlantic Way, stopping at charming villages and breathtaking viewpoints. The nearby Westport House, a grand 16th-century estate, offers a fascinating glimpse into aristocratic life and is surrounded by beautiful parklands. Exploring the local craft shops and enjoying traditional Irish music sessions in nearby pubs will further enrich your cultural immersion.
